MEM2012V181RT001 Details

  • Manufacturer Part Number:

    MEM2012V181RT001

  • Rohs Code:

    Yes

  • Part Life Cycle Code:

    Active

  • ECCN Code:

    EAR99

  • HTS Code:

    8504.50.80.00

  • Factory Lead Time:

    15 Weeks

  • Manufacturer:

    TDK Corporation

  • YTEOL:

    7.19

  • Additional Feature:

    CUTOFF FREQUENCY 180 MHZ

  • Filter Type:

    DATA LINE FILTER

  • Height:

    0.85 mm

  • Insertion Loss-Max:

    20 dB

  • Length:

    2 mm

  • Mounting Type:

    SURFACE MOUNT

  • Number of Functions:

    1

  • Number of Terminals:

    3

  • Operating Temperature-Max:

    85 °C

  • Operating Temperature-Min:

    -40 °C

  • Packing Method:

    TR, 7 INCH

  • Rated Current:

    0.1 A

  • Rated Voltage:

    10 V

  • Width:

    1.25 mm
